Motion deblurring filter python, On this page only a linear

Motion deblurring filter python, On this page only a linear motion blur distortion is considered. For example, training, testing and deblurring with numerous SOTA models can be performed with just 2-3 lines of code with the default parameters mentioned in each paper. Mar 29, 2023 · DBlur: An Image Deblurring Toolkit DBlur is an open-source python library for image deblurring. - MyNiuuu/MAD-Avatar Jan 28, 2020 · What do we do? In this work, we propose a self-supervised model for motion deblurring. On this page only a linear computer-vision pytorch image-restoration motion-deblurring image-dehazing defocus-deblurring image-deraining iclr2023 image-desnowing frequency-selection Updated on Feb 5, 2025 Python Nov 11, 2019 · So I have been asked to motion deblur a frame captured from a video, I am kind of new to this deblur filters so need help. Jan 8, 2013 · Prev Tutorial: Out-of-focus Deblur Filter Next Tutorial: Anisotropic image segmentation by a gradient structure tensor Goal In this tutorial you will learn: what the PSF of a motion blur image is how to restore a motion blur image Theory For the degradation image model theory and the Wiener filter theory you can refer to the tutorial Out-of-focus Deblur Filter. What is the PSF of a motion blur image? We propose a novel real-world deblurring filtering model called the Motion-adaptive Separable Collaborative (MISC) Filter. Instead of learning deblurring from paired blurry and sharp image pairs, our method explicitly takes into account the image formation process (i. While it requires some parameter tuning and knowledge of the blur characteristics, it can produce remarkable results when applied correctly. We will analyze what makes the process of deblurring an image (blurred with a known blur kernel) – deconvolution – possible in theory, what makes it impossible (at least to realize “perfectly”) in practice, and what a practical middle ground looks 5 days ago · Theory For the degradation image model theory and the Wiener filter theory you can refer to the tutorial Out-of-focus Deblur Filter. This can be done by defining a mathematical model of the blurring process with the idea of removing from the image the blurring effects. It is simple and highly versatile making it perfect for both experts and non-experts in the field. The eventual goal is to get a clear image from a moving camera installed on our design team satelitte. Image deblurring # Deblurring is the process of removing blurring effects from images, caused for example by defocus aberration or motion blur. On the other hand, these Image deblurring is a method that aims at recovering the original sharp-image by removing effect caused by limited aperture, lens aberrations, defocus, and unintended motions. 05. The blur was caused by a moving subject. As for the required library, I use a mixture of OpenCV, Scipy and PIL Below are the list of image processing methods that I . e. May 26, 2022 · In this post, we’ll have a look at the idea of removing blur from images, videos, or games through a process called “deconvolution”. We analyze the relationship between the motion estimation network for producing filter deep-learning convolutional-neural-networks motion-blur inverse-problems deconvolution motion-estimation deblurring wiener-filter motion-blur-elimination blind-deconvolution linear-blurs Readme Activity 37 stars [CVPR 2026] Official PyTorch Implementation for "Motion-Aware Animatable Gaussian Avatars Deblurring". As part of my work for UBC Orbit Payload Team, I have to do research on deblurring/blurring, adding/removing noise, detect blur from images and process them in Python. The motion blur image on this page is a real world image. , how a blurry image is generated) to learn motion deblurring from blurry inputs alone. The video does not contain any noise, just a vertical motion blur. It targets the shortcomings of existing methods that focus only on image residual reconstruction in feature space and can handle more generalized and complex motion in image space. In forward mode, such blurring effect is typically modelled as a 2-dimensional convolution between the so-called point spread function and a target sharp input image, where the sharp input image (which has to be recovered) is unknown and the point The Wiener filter provides a mathematically sound approach to deblurring motion-blurred images in OpenCV.


q6qv, mwpw, jqtuy, xeg8, 324xw, ii3er3, czswj, tncpyw, geil, zcqxf,